The purpose of this study was to determine whether waist-to-height ratio (W/HtR) is an effective index for assessing abdominal fat and cardiovascular disease risk factors in middle aged women. The participants included in this study were ninety-eight middle aged women. The age, height, weight and body mass index of the subjects were 49.2±7.2years, 155.6±4.8㎝, 66.6±8.3㎏ and 27.5±3.0(㎏/㎡). All subjects were included in the study after informed consent was obtained. There was significant correlations between W/HtR and weight (r=0.580, P<.0001). The W/HtR is positively correlated with BMI (r=0.734, P<.0001). The fat mass (r=0.692, P<.0001), %fat (r=0.600, P<.0001) and WHR (r=0.882, P<.0001) were significantly correlated with the W/HtH. The total fat area (r=0.830, P<.0001), subcutaneous fat area (r=0.758, P<.0001), visceral fat area (r=0.676, P<.0001), and ViS ratio (r=0.270, P<.0001) in abdominal fat area were also significantly correlated with the W/HtH. There were significant correlations between W/HtR and HDLC (r=-0.349, P<.001), AI (r=0.199, P<.001), TG (r=0.270, P<.001). The slopes of regression equation showed that WHR, TFA were two best indicators to predict waist/height ratio (W/HtR). We propose to use W/HtR for detecting abdominal fat and cardiovascular disease risk factors in middle-aged women, because the W/HtR is the effective index of anthropometric variables, abdominal fat and CVD risk factors in middle-aged women. As a simple and non-invasive method for a assessing abdominal fat and obesity, anthropometric measurements could be efficiently used in epidemiologic study and clinical screening.
